In this paper, the capacity of spectrally overlaid narrowband code division multiple access (N-CDMA) and wideband CDMA (W-CDMA) system using single code and multicode will be analysed. The system is made to bring multiclass services, in where the N-CDMA will be used to serve voice communication and W-CDMA is used for high speed data transmitting. Two different methods are used for data transmission. The first one is the conventional method that uses different spreading gain for transmitting different class of service, and the second one is multicode. It is shown that the capacity of the system using multicode is better than that of system using single code.
